WebApr 19, 2024 · The basic idea of graph-based machine learning is based on the nodes and edges of the graph, Node: The node in a graph describes as the viewpoint of an object’s … WebThe theory of graph cuts used as an optimization method was first applied in computer vision in the seminal paper by Greig, Porteous and Seheult [3] of Durham University. Allan Seheult and Bruce Porteous were members of Durham's lauded statistics group of the time, led by Julian Besag and Peter Green (statistician), with the optimisation expert ...
